Unreal Blueprint is a production-ready tool that empowers AI agents to programmatically create and modify Unreal Engine Blueprints using natural language. It provides a robust WebSocket client implementation for external AI to control the Unreal Blueprint Editor via JSON-RPC 2.0, supporting real-time blueprint creation, property modification, component addition, and compilation, all with comprehensive error handling and UI integration for seamless AI-driven game development.